Transaction 74e4b64e67dda3aa3ab84f7c4688cc54b330e2e675e44b53783e5e9a2301fa57
1 Input
1 Output
-
74e4b64e67dda3aa3ab84f7c4688cc54b330e2e675e44b53783e5e9a2301fa57:0
- value
- 1080676
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 811b6c34ec0f3737db03cdf87006a877e9a13c33 OP_EQUAL
- address
- 3DTfwej6v7AwCjraR9FAkSjY5e3EcLwJhs